Enter your information for the year and … pale pink hat for weddingWebJan 24, 2024 · Using the Ontario taxpayer as an example, income between $43,906 and $47,630 is taxed at a combined federal/provincial rate of 24.15 per cent. Once it crosses over $47,630, the tax rate jumps to 29.65 per cent for income up to $77,313. The trick is to make a large enough contribution to lower your taxable income to a lower marginal rate. pale pink glitter background
